Responsibilities

  • To provide the GCAT Chief Executive and Board with any information needed to ensure good governance of the organisation.
  • To ensure effective financial stewardship of GCAT, ensuring a robust and secure financial system for the organisation.
  • To deliver GCAT’s aims and objectives, policies and activities in relation to the Business Support Programme.
  • To provide an effective business support function which underpins and supports the effectiveness of GCAT as a whole; motivating other relevant staff to achieve this.
  • To support the preparation and implementation of business strategies, plans and budgets for all service areas.
  • To work with the GCAT Chief Executive, colleagues, contractors, users and key relevant partners to ensure quality and to develop the future direction of the Business Support Programme.

Permanent position with full employee rights. 28 hours a week, based at the CatStrand, New Galloway. Flexible working available.
